    If you love coffee, definitely check out Philz. As others have mentioned, they do have a more limited menu. However, quality definitely beats quantity. I tried the Tesoro, which is a medium blend with a nice caramel undertone. My friends ordered the iced Rosé coffee, and it sounds (and looks!) good. There is also a limited food menu, but the breakfast burritos are yummy and filling! I definitely can't wait to go back and try other blends. In addition to great coffee, Philz is doing their part to help the environment by using compostable lids and paper cups. Get your coffee fix and feel good about doing your part as well!

    **This review is for the Thursday soft opening** I work in the area and decided to stop by to check out Philz for the soft opening. A roommate of mine gifted me some beans from Philz last year and I loved them but until today I had never been inside one of their locations. I didn't know what to expect but I was thoroughly impressed. Philz is a different kind of coffee shop experience. It's a coffee-forward, barista-forward place. Rather than serving espresso drinks, Philz has a variety of different coffee blends with recommended ways to drink (medium cream, add honey, etc.). You walk up to the barista counter to place your order instead of at the cash register. I have to say that I loved this aspect! The baristas here are incredibly warm and inviting. They are happy to discuss your tastes and preferences, giving recommendations for blends and styles. Not only is this super helpful but it encouraged warm interaction. I felt welcomed rather than like a coffee-illiterate nuisance (which other coffee shops have made me feel like!). After you speak with a barista to place your order, head over to the register to pay. It was packed, which is to be expected for a soft opening. The surprise, however, was how quick and friendly the service was before they're even open. I was expecting a long wait but I was up to the barista counter very quickly. I'm so thrilled this Philz is in the neighborhood and I'm excited to stop by again.
